Android Developer
Role details
Job location
Tech stack
Job description
joining a group of software enthusiasts, working in an international agile team setup, creating products that make the difference in the entire airline industry - then apply now! What you will do: You will be responsible for the design, development, and maintenance of the Android mobile application You make sure no regression bugs occur by conducting automated tests Together with the team, we make sure that the app meets the standards of software development and the newest design approaches Finding creative solutions for technological requirements Further development of existing systems and processes You handle the stakeholder requirements in an agile way and collaborate with partners You work in an international environment with a highly diverse team Required skills: 3-4 years of experience (for a mid role) Good knowledge of Kotlin Practical knowledge of design & UX patterns using JetPack Compose Practical knowledge Atomic Design Architectural patterns such as MVVM, MVI Experience
Requirements
with coroutines, flows... Experience with workflow tools (e.g. Jira) Experience in communication with REST API Disciplined and detailed approach to developing, testing and documenting clean code Knowledge of common processes of agile software development Passion for mobile development A deep understanding of different stakeholders' needs and ability to provide and communicate different technical solutions Very good command of the English language Our offering: You will grow professionally in a company in constant development and evolution. You will benefit from a personalized follow-up of your professional projects as close as possible to your ambitions. You will make a real contribution to the company's development in real time. ️ You will enjoy 23 days of vacation. You will join our team: diverse, multicultural and constantly growing. You will have days full of good energy and good atmosphere.